Math
- The child practiced measuring ingredients using fractions, enhancing their understanding of fractions in a real-life context.
- They calculated the cooking time and temperature, applying their knowledge of time and temperature conversions.
- The child doubled the recipe, reinforcing their multiplication skills.
- They divided the final dish into equal portions, strengthening their division abilities.
Physical Education
- The child engaged in physical activity while preparing the meal, improving their coordination and motor skills.
- They learned about proper posture and body mechanics while standing, cutting, and stirring, promoting good physical health.
- The child followed instructions and practiced following a sequence of steps, enhancing their listening and cognitive skills.
- They practiced time management by coordinating different tasks simultaneously, fostering their organizational abilities.
Science
- The child learned about the chemical reactions that occur during cooking, such as browning or caramelization.
- They explored the concept of heat transfer and the different methods of cooking, like boiling, baking, or frying.
- The child gained an understanding of food safety and hygiene practices, such as washing hands and avoiding cross-contamination.
- They learned about the nutritional value of the ingredients used and the importance of a balanced diet.

Book Recommendations
- The Way the Cookie Crumbled by Jody Jensen Shaffer: Explores the history and science of baking cookies.
- Math Potatoes by Greg Tang: Presents math concepts through fun and engaging food-themed poems and illustrations.
- What's Cooking? Poems About Food by Cynthia Cotten: A collection of food-themed poems that celebrate the joy of cooking and eating.
